2017-11-09 12 views
0

<display:table> 태그를 사용하여 웹 페이지에 데이터를 표시하고 있습니다.디스플레이 태그의 마지막 행을 얻는 방법

<display:table style="min-width: 180%; max-width: 180%; table-layout: inherit;" 
          class="ui small orange celled unstackable table" requestURI="JobFromInvoiceAEPre" 
          name="productList" pagesize="5" id="jobtable" export="false" 
          clearStatus="${param['filter'] != null}" excludedParams="filter"> 

Columns are here.. 
. 
. 
</display:table> 

내 데이터베이스 테이블에는 50 개의 데이터가 있고 테이블 태그를 생성하면 페이지 당 5 개의 데이터 페이지 매김을 만들 수 있습니다.

제 질문은 페이지 테이블 태그의 표시 테이블 태그에서 마지막 행 데이터를 얻는 방법입니다.

내가 마지막 행

$('#jobtable').find('tr:last').find('td').eq(
           2).find('input:text').val(); 

에 대한 코드 아래에이를 사용하고 있지만 매김 페이지와 같은 특정 페이지의 마지막 행을 반환하는 것은 2 다음은 행 10 번을 반환합니다.

모든 페이지에서 행 no.50에서 데이터를 가져 오는 방법을 원합니다. 어떻게해야합니까? 항목의 표시 태그 총 수에서

답변

0

내가 너무 많은 생각 후에 대답을 얻었다 ...

헤더의 이상에 표시됩니다.

실제로이 전체 메시지는 클래스 이름이 페이지 배너 인 스팬에 있습니다. 나는 범위 및 분할 총 수의 part.code에서 데이터를 얻을입니다

var dtxt= document.getElementsByClassName('pagebanner')[0].innerHTML; 

below-이며, 분할 코드는 나에게 마지막 행 번호를 제공

var txt=dtxt.split('items')[0].trim(); 

이하입니다.

다른 의견이 있으면 공유하십시오.